Shuswap Nation Tribal Council Welcome to the Shuswap Nation Tribal Council. SNTC was formed in 1980 as an effort of the Secwepemc chiefs to advance the issues of aboriginal rights.

Today, our team came together in our orange shirts to honor the National Day for Truth and Reconciliation.
This day is a time to reflect on the painful history and lasting impacts of residential schools, to listen to Survivors, and to stand in solidarity with Indigenous communities. By wearing orange, we remember the children who never returned home and commit ourselves to reconciliation through awareness, respect, and action.

APPLY NOW! SALMON WARRIORS FALL GATHERING OCT. 15-19, 2025

APPLICATION DEADLINE: Mon. Sept. 15, 2025
EVENT DATES: 3pm Wed. Oct. 15 to 12pm Sun. Oct. 19, 2025
LOCATION: Penticton, BC; Okanagan River (near Oliver, BC)

The Salmon Warriors Fall Gathering 2025 is open to Syilx Okanagan, Ktunaxa, and Secwépemc young adults ages 19-29 yrs. New and returning Salmon Warriors are encouraged to apply. Dams have blocked our salmon from returning to the upper Columbia River for over 86 years; the salmon need their people. Join other young adults from our three Nations to learn and connect with one another, the water and the land about what it will take to bring our salmon home.

What to Expect: This year’s Salmon Warriors Fall Gathering will be hosted in Penticton, BC. We’ll be getting hands-on experience in the Okanagan River near Oliver, and at the Okanagan Nation Alliance’s kł cp̓əlk̓ stim̓ Fish Hatchery, at Penticton Indian Band.

The first day on Wednesday is check in, opening and dinner. The next day is team building and cultural activities. The third and fourth days are spent assisting the ONA Fisheries Team with the annual salmon broodstock collection at the river and the hatchery. The final day will be breakfast, closing and check out.

Full attendance and participation is required throughout.

The Salmon Warriors initiative is dedicated to protecting, restoring, and advocating for the health of our salmon, which are vital to our people, culture, and lands.
By joining the Salmon Warriors, individuals will have the opportunity to take part in meaningful work that supports the strength of our waters and the future of our salmon. Deadline to apply: September 11, 2025
